The issue is coming part from how you configured HikaShop and part from your template.
You turned on the "use bootstrap design" option of the HikaShop configuration but that option should only be activated if your template is compatible with bootstrap.
Turn off that option and you'll get back several columns in your listings.

Hi,

Edit the module with the id 136 via the menu Display>Content modules and make sure that the "sub element filter" option is set to "direct sub elements" and that the "synchronise with ...." option is turned on.
If that's already the case, then it would mean that the products are linked to the main category which you don't want if you don't want them to appear on the main listing.
